Login
Резюме для программиста
89957 просмотров
Перейти к просмотру всей ветки
in Antwort alex445 19.10.21 14:21, Zuletzt geändert 19.10.21 17:15 (alex445)
Встретилась задачка
class My
{
public int Prop { get; set; }
}
public static List<My> list = new List<My>();
static void Main(string[] args)
{
My item = new My() { Prop = 5 };
list.Add(item);
list.Add(item);
list.Add(item);
foreach (var o in list)
Console.WriteLine(o.Prop);
list.Remove(item);
Console.WriteLine();
foreach (var o in list)
Console.WriteLine(o.Prop);
}
Вывод в консоли
5
5
5
5
5
Какой конкретно объект был удалён из списка list и почему именно этот?